    My family and I came here for dinner and we were able to get a show and a dinner. This restaurant is the brainchild of Blake Shelton, so obviously it's country music themed. There's even a life sized cardboard cutout of Blake by the stage. They serve up southern food (i.e. BBQ, burgers, cornbread) and have live music. There's also a rooftop bar with a great view of the strip that I think turns into a nightclub later in the evening. The names of some of the dishes made me laugh: Trash Talkin' Taco Salad, Redneck Nachos...My family and I ordered the Stay Country BBQ Board (feeds 2-3) & the Carolina Glazed Roasted Half Chicken. The food was fine but nothing extraordinary. Don't expect to be able to talk to the people in your party. The live music is so loud that we couldn't hear each other. There's also an entertainment fee that is tacked on to your bill at the end to pay for the live band. Apparently that's a thing in Vegas?

    Expensive Venue on the Strip This is a 3-level venue with a 4th level rooftop. Surprisingly, it wasn't overly crowded for a Saturday night. Pricing: The drink prices are steep. Expect to pay nearly $20 for a beer and closer to $30 for a mixed drink. Entertainment: There is an additional $2 entertainment charge added to your bill. The live band was okay. Overall, the pricing is a bit excessive for the overall experience. Fine for one drink if you haven't been, but not a place to settle in for the night unless you're prepared to spend a lot.

    We visited Ole Red on a Friday afternoon for a late lunch. It was definitely busy. There was a live band playing inside, but we wanted to sit on the rooftop. Unfortunately, all the tables overlooking the Strip and the Bellagio Fountains were taken, so we were seated by stage on the rooftop. There wasn't any entertainment on that rooftop stage while we were there, which made it a little confusing to see an entertainment fee added to our receipt. Our server was very sweet, but she clearly had too many tables. There were long stretches where we didn't see her, so we're guessing she may have had tables on another floor as well. Service just felt stretched thin. As for the food we ordered the nachos, fried green tomatoes, cornbread, and mac n' cheese. The fried green tomatoes were good and probably our favorite starter. The nachos were just okay. The cornbread was okay. The parts with melted butter were good, but it needed more or would have been great served with some honey. The mac n' cheese was good and very rich, which you kind of expect at a Southern country bar. On our way out, we heard the band playing inside and they sounded great. Overall, it's a fun spot with a lively vibe. We just wish the service had been more attentive and that we could have snagged one of those rooftop tables with a view.

    Can minors go to the establishment?

    Yes they can

    What's the dress code? Can I wear shorts?

    No dress code. It's very relaxed in there.

    Is there dancing and or a dance floor to dance on?

    Yes there is. Right in front of the stage.

    Any entrance fee?

    No cover, at least not during lunch or dinner hours and they keep the live music going pretty much all day.

    Is it young kid (age 4-5) friendly for lunch?

    Yes for sure. Really fun place for that

    When is the kitchen's last order?

    9:30 pm

    Where a good place to park?

    Horseshoe hotel

    Can our small puppy come for a visit with us?

    Honestly don't know, I didn't see any dogs when I was there

    Do we have to make a reservation for 4th floor rooftop outside?

    I used Opendoor for my reservation but there's not a way to pick your place to sit. But I can only suspect that once you make the reservations you could call ahead or something.

    Are kids allowed during late night evening hours?

    They can go up until 10pm.
